The spaceship during it´s first earth-approaching shot,
done stopframe with 75 frames per second.
This three times more frames were later reduced to the third of speed by interpolating them, and this smoother result was then additionally motionblurred digitally, with the right amount of blurring.
The tricky thing about this was to get the right timing into all this because everything was done manually
and frame - by - frame ( cameramovement, cameratrack, 2 modelmover-axes), but some calculations done from time to time helped to get the right thinking for this
unfamiliar animation-feeling by shooting 75 frames instead of the usual 25 frames...
